Color Commentary - A Fantasy Football Podcast with Ramiro and J-Mar

Fantasy Football is ridiculous—and that’s why we love it. Ramiro and J-Mar have been playing for over a decade, trash-talking their way through league wins, crushing defeats, and way too many wings. Now they’re bringing the same energy to the mic: bold takes, the latest strategies, and plenty of laughs. Whether you’re chasing trophies or just trying not to come last, pull up a chair—this is Fantasy Football the way your friends actually talk about it.
